Strategic Betting: Beyond Gut Feelings
Once you’ve built a solid foundation of knowledge, it’s time to develop a strategic betting approach. This involves setting clear goals, managing your bankroll responsibly, and choosing your bets wisely.
Setting clear goals is essential for staying focused and avoiding impulsive decisions. Are you aiming for consistent small wins, or are you willing to take on more risk for the potential of larger payouts? Defining your objectives will help you tailor your betting strategy accordingly.
Bankroll management is arguably the most crucial aspect of successful betting. It involves setting a budget for your betting activities and sticking to it, regardless of wins or losses. A common rule of thumb is to bet no more than 1-5% of your bankroll on any single wager. This helps to minimize the impact of losing streaks and protects your capital.
Choosing your bets wisely involves carefully evaluating the odds and probabilities associated with each potential wager. Don’t simply bet on your favorite team or the team you think “should” win. Instead, focus on identifying value – situations where the odds offered by the bookmaker are higher than your own assessment of the probability of that outcome occurring. Navigating the Odds: Deciphering the Language of Betting
Understanding odds is fundamental to successful football betting. Odds represent the ratio between the amount staked by a bettor and the potential winnings. They are presented in various formats, including decimal, fractional, and American odds.
Decimal odds are the simplest to understand. They represent the total payout you would receive for every unit staked, including your original stake. For example, decimal odds of 2.50 mean that a $10 bet would return $25 ($10 stake + $15 profit).
Fractional odds are commonly used in the UK. They represent the profit you would receive for every unit staked. For example, fractional odds of 2/1 mean that a $1 bet would return a $2 profit, in addition to your original $1 stake.
American odds are used primarily in the United States. They express the amount you need to wager to win $100, or the amount you would win for a $100 wager. Positive odds indicate the amount you would win for a $100 wager, while negative odds indicate the amount you need to wager to win $100.
Understanding how to convert between these different formats is essential for comparing odds across different bookmakers and identifying the best value.

The Importance of Discipline: Staying the Course
Discipline is paramount in the world of football betting. It’s easy to get caught up in the excitement of a winning streak or to become discouraged by a series of losses. However, successful bettors maintain a disciplined approach, sticking to their strategy and avoiding emotional decisions.
Avoid chasing losses. It’s tempting to try to recoup your losses by placing larger bets, but this often leads to further losses and can quickly deplete your bankroll. Instead, stick to your bankroll management plan and avoid making impulsive decisions based on emotion.
Don’t bet on every match. Just because there’s a football match on doesn’t mean you have to bet on it. Focus on identifying matches where you have a strong understanding of the teams involved and where you believe you have an edge.
Take breaks. Football betting can be mentally taxing, especially during busy periods. Taking regular breaks can help you clear your head and avoid burnout.
Regularly review your performance. Tracking your bets and analyzing your results can help you identify areas where you are succeeding and areas where you need to improve. This feedback loop is essential for continuous learning and improvement.
